Home of Peace Cemetery
Cemetery
Home of Peace Memorial Park and Mortuary, also called Home of Peace Cemetery, is a Jewish cemetery in Los Angeles County, California. It is located at 4334 Whittier Boulevard west of Interstate 710 in East Los Angeles. Home of Peace Cemetery is situated 2,500 feet west of Whittier Boulevard Arch.
Calvary Cemetery
Cemetery
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Calvary Cemetery is a Roman Catholic cemetery that the Archdiocese of Los Angeles operates in the community of East Los Angeles, California. It is also called "New Calvary Cemetery" because it succeeded the original Calvary Cemetery, over which Cathedral High School was built. Calvary Cemetery is situated 3,600 feet northwest of Whittier Boulevard Arch.
Maravilla station
Railway station
Photo: HanSangYoon,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Maravilla station is an at-grade light rail station on the E Line of the Los Angeles Metro Rail system. It is located at the intersection of 3rd Street and Ford Boulevard in East Los Angeles, California near Interstate 710. Maravilla station is situated 3,900 feet north of Whittier Boulevard Arch.
